WHEREAS, It is with great sadness that the members of this Chamber learned of God, in His Infinite Wisdom, calling home a most beloved citizen, Ms. Doris Louise Ivy, to her eternal reward; and

WHEREAS, The Chicago City Council has been informed of her transition by the Honorable Walter Burnett, Jr., Alderman of the 27th Ward; and

WHEREAS, Ms. Doris L. Ivy was bom on April 23, 1933, to the late Jesse Clark White, Sr. and Julia White, in Alton, Illinois, then at an early age, she and her family moved to Chicago, Illinois; and

WHEREAS, Ms. Doris L. Ivy married Arthur Lee Crume, Sr., and of that union, one child was born. Later, marrying the late Arthur Ivy, they were the devoted parents of nine additional children, and in-turn, receiving a wealth of grandchildren and great grandchildren; and

WHEREAS, Ms. Doris L. Ivy served this earthly kingdom lovingly as a daughter, sister, wife, mother, grandmother, and friend. She was also a member ofthe Greater St. John Missionary Baptist Church, singing in their choir; member of the William V. Banks Grand Lodge Order of Eastern Stars, mentoring women on leadership and in bible study; and a volunteer for the 27th Ward Regular Democratic Organization, supporting the senior citizen community along with being a Judge of Election for more than thirty years; and
